Asbestos is a fibrous rock that has many industrial uses and was used in building and construction materials for decades due to its fire resistance and flexible. It also has a high tensile strength. Unfortunately, asbestos is also toxic and can cause a variety of mesothelioma-related diseases, including lung cancer and pleural mesothelioma which can be fatal. Asbestos victims require legal representation to seek financial compensation for funeral costs and lost income.

The best mesothelioma lawyers have special expertise in asbestos litigation, and can help clients understand their rights. This type of lawyer operates on a contingent fee basis. This means that attorney's fees are dependent upon the outcome of a settlement or verdict that is favorable for their client. Lawyers can charge for legal research, writing documents, conducting depositions and defending them, as well as conducting trials, and other related tasks.

It is crucial to engage an experienced attorney as quickly as possible after a mesothelioma diagnosis or the death of a loved one who died from an asbestos-related disease. The statute of limitation only gives a certain period of time to file a lawsuit. This limit is usually dependent on the date when the diagnosis was made for personal injury cases as well as the date the death occurred for wrongful death claims.

A national firm that concentrates in asbestos litigation has access to databases and other important information that can help patients determine when, where and how they were affected by asbestos. This information is essential in seeking compensation from asbestos manufacturers who are responsible for health issues of the asbestos victims.

A trustworthy mesothelioma lawyer can provide victims with information about possible asbestos trust funds from which they could be eligible for financial compensation. Several asbestos companies filed for bankruptcy, and although the majority of these firms can't be sued, their assets can still be tapped for victims to receive compensation. Those who suffer from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ses that are related to work are eligible to receive compensation under the workers compensation system. In order to obtain this help the person suffering from the condition must prove that he or she was exposed to asbestos while at work and that this exposure caused his or her disease.

Anyone who has been diagnosed with an asbestos-related disease should consult a lawyer as soon as they can. Mesothelioma is a potentially fatal cancer, but it is difficult to recognize. It usually develops years after exposure. An experienced attorney can help the victim and her family gather evidence, such as medical records and employment records in order to establish a successful claim for compensation.

The time limit for personal injury cases is three years but this can be extended for m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related illness claims. Mesothelioma symptoms can develop over decades and those affected could have worked or lived in various locations around the world.
